Rocket Innovation Studio: Shopping Cart App
$100 Awarded to the winning team!
A web application where customers can view products, add them to their cart, and checkout
Customers should maintain a set balance on their accounts but cannot make a purchase with their cart should the total cost exceed their remaining balance
Key features:
Store webpage
Contains a list of available products with prices
Customers have the option to add products to their cart
Cart webpage
Customers can view the items in their cart
Customers can edit the quantity of any item they have in their cart
Customers can remove any item they want from their cart
Checkout webpage
Customers should only be able to checkout if they have items in their cart
Checkout is only successful if there is enough remaining balance for the purchase
Purchase History webpage
Customers can view their transaction history (items purchased, date/time, cost)
Rocket Innovation Studio: Planning Poker App
$100 Awarded to the winning team!
A web tool that allows players (developers) to estimate the amount of work it will take to complete tasks
Players can enter a session via a session ID, where they can start casting votes based on the Fibonacci sequence for estimation
Key features:
Starting web page
An admin player can create a session with an ID that others can join via button
Players can enter their displayed name and a session ID to join
Session web page
Players can view the presence of other players in the session
This page will have a text box containing the name of the task being estimated on that all players can view
This page will have a selection of Fibonacci numbers to choose from for task estimation
These numbers go from 0 to 13 as a Fibonacci sequence
After all players have voted, all votes may be revealed by the admin
